2015-05-10 Thread richard jones
I think I have the same problem on an Acer Aspire 5920 laptop. The machine hangs very early in the boot process on Ubuntu 3.19.0-17-generic, but boots successfully using recovery mode, or booting 3.19.0-16-generic. Let me know if I can provide further info. I may need detailed instructions. Thanks.
